During the Medieval Warm Period, or Medieval Climate Anomaly (MCA), the ocean heat uptake rates had dipped to about 1500 ZJ.

Today (2000 CE), the global ocean heat uptake has fallen to just 500 ZJ. In other words, even with the warming since 1750, we are still only about one-third of the way back to the ocean heat content values achieved 1000 years ago, when CO2 was 275 ppm.

“…the ~500 ZJ of heat uptake during the modern warming era is just one-third of what is required to reach MCA levels.”

Putting ocean heat uptake rates in a temperature context, the top-to-bottom ocean is today (1994-2013) warming at a rate of just 0.0011°C per year (Wunsch, 2018). This is an annual warming rate slightly more than one one-thousandths of a degree.
